The Defence Research and Development Organisation (DRDO) has successfully completed user evaluation trials of the Akash-NG missile system, marking a major step towards its induction into the Indian Air Force. Conducted at a test facility with the participation of IAF personnel, the trials validated the system’s ability to intercept multiple aerial targets under diverse operational conditions.
The Akash-NG, or Next Generation Akash, is designed to provide a robust air defence shield against a wide spectrum of aerial threats including aircraft, drones, and cruise missiles. The missile is equipped with an indigenous Radio Frequency seeker and powered by a solid rocket motor, enabling high manoeuvrability and precision engagement across ranges and altitudes.
The system comprises advanced components such as a Multi-Function Radar, Command and Control Unit, and Missile Launch Vehicle, all developed indigenously in collaboration with Indian industry partners. During the evaluation, the missile successfully demonstrated its capability to neutralize targets in complex scenarios, including low-altitude near-boundary threats and long-range high-altitude engagements.
